Game Design using Python Programming for Beginners (8 to 12 years)

Time: 10 am to 12:30 pm

Each week, children will design a new project using Turtle graphics.

At Pure Minds Academy's Winter Camp, we're excited to offer a specially tailored Python course for young enthusiasts aged 8-12 years. In this fun and engaging program, children will embark on an exciting exploration of the world of coding and game design using Python.

With our expert instructors guiding them, they'll learn the basics of programming, creating simple games, and even delve into the magic of graphics. It's a perfect introduction to the power of technology and igniting their artistic expression in a supportive and interactive environment.

The key concepts that will be covered in this program are: 

  • Introduction to Python's syntax and structure.
  • Learn to work with variables, numbers, strings, and lists.
  • Understand if statements to make decisions in games.
  • Explore loops to create repetitive actions and animations.
  • Write functions to organize code and perform specific tasks.
  • Capture input from players to make games interactive.
  • Create visuals and animations using Python's graphics libraries.
  • Develop game rules and interactions within the projects.
  • Learn debugging techniques to fix errors in the code.

By the end of this course, you'll have a solid grasp of these Python concepts and the ability to use them to design and code your own simple games.

NCFE Accredited Course: Game Design using Python Programming (10 to 16 years)

Time: 10 am to 1:30 pm

Week 1: Flappy Bird
Week 2: Tron
Week 3: Jumpy
 

To gain NCFE accreditation, a student must complete at least 2 weeks of this program. 

Pure Minds Academy is proud to be the exclusive NCFE-accredited satellite center in the GCC region, offering an exciting "Game Design using Python" program designed specifically for beginners aged 10-16. This comprehensive course empowers young minds to enter the dynamic world of game design and programming.

Students will acquire foundational Python programming skills while exploring the intricacies of game development, honing their creative and problem-solving abilities. With NCFE accreditation, participants gain internationally recognized certification, enhancing their academic and professional prospects.

Their projects will also be an outstanding piece of the portfolio that will impress at any potential school or college interview!

The key concepts covered in this program are:

  • Learning the fundamentals of Python, a versatile and beginner-friendly language.
  • Utilizing Turtle graphics for creating visuals and animation, introducing the concept of objects.
  • Understanding variables, loops, and conditional statements to manage game states and interactions.
  • Mastering conditional statements for decision-making in games.
  • Developing game logic, incorporating principles of object-oriented programming for code organization and modularity.
  • Introducing basic AI concepts for creating interactive game elements.
  • Familiarizing with Pygame, an object-oriented library that simplifies game development.
  • Utilizing object-oriented principles to create and manage game objects and animations.
  • Capturing user input using object-oriented techniques for game control.
  • Implementing object-oriented collision detection and game physics.
  • Applying object-oriented principles to create multiple game levels, enhancing gameplay.
  • Exploring game design principles and object-oriented programming for an engaging player experience.
  • Integrating all concepts and skills to create full-fledged games.

Throughout the course, students will gain valuable experience in object-oriented programming, setting a strong foundation for future endeavors in coding and game design.

What is NCFE?

NCFE is an awarding organisation and registered educational charity providing qualifications in England, Wales and Northern Ireland, in the United Kingdom. NCFE is regulated by Ofqual in England, and recognised by Qualifications Wales and the Council for the Curriculum, Examinations & Assessment in Northern Ireland.
